Output 3bb066b44351456731f4a038fe11a8f3ab05c158cb60a9423483d999297911e8:13

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1db5c9ccf5bf50ff0825cae6b55f33554bc58f4 OP_EQUAL
address
A8eh3sDKbKPW2nXcfwfwfMzKeijVYX98P8
transaction
3bb066b44351456731f4a038fe11a8f3ab05c158cb60a9423483d999297911e8